Step-by-Step Guide: Air Conditioner Leaks Through Ceiling; What To Do Next

Air conditioner leaks through ceiling are alarming. Not only do they pose a risk to your home’s structure, but also increases the threat of mold growth. Follow this step-by-step guide to help manage and prevent water damage from your air conditioning unit while you wait for a professional to help mediate the damage.

Immediate Steps to Take When Air Conditioner Leaks Through Ceiling

Safety first: Turn off the power to the area affected by the leak to prevent electrical hazards before starting any work.

1. Identify the Source of the Leak

Start by locating where the water is coming from, which could be a result of condensation from the AC unit. Turn off the AC unit before applying the below steps.

  1. Inspect the AC Unit: Check the condensate pan and drain lines for clogs or overflows.
  2. Check Installation Errors: Ensure that all components are properly installed and that the unit is level.

2. Address and Repair the Leak

Once you’ve identified the source, take corrective measures to fix the problem.

  1. Clear Blocked Drains: Use a wet/dry vacuum to clear any obstructions in the drain line.
  2. Identify Damaged Parts: Identify or repair any damaged parts of the AC unit that could be causing the leak. You may need to call a professional during this step to help replace or repair a part.

3. Dry Out the Affected Area

Prevent mold growth by thoroughly drying out the area where the leak occurred. If you notice mold, call a professional right away. Visit the epa.gov page for more resources on mold and it’s effects in the home.

  1. Use Fans and Dehumidifiers: Increase air circulation and reduce moisture with fans and dehumidifiers.
  2. Remove Wet Insulation: Replace any insulation that has gotten wet to prevent mold buildup.

Time-Frame: Varies depending on the extent of moisture

4. Prevent Future Leaks

Implement measures to prevent future leaks and protect your home.

  1. Regular Maintenance: Schedule regular maintenance checks to ensure your AC system is functioning properly.
  2. Inspect Regularly: Regularly check for signs of moisture or damage around your AC unit, especially before and after the cooling season.
